  • Abstract
    With the popularity of digital camera and the application requirement of digitalized document images, using digital cameras to digitalize document images has become an irresistible trend. However, the warping of the document surface is sometimes unavoidable. The warped surface can lead to document image distortion, especially at the book spine. This impacts on the quality of the OCR (Optical Character Recognition) recognition system seriously. This paper presents a warped document image mosaicing method based on registration and a composing transformation of Translation, Rotation and Scaling, called TRS transform. This method mosaics two warped images of the same document from different viewpoints through feature extraction, image registration, etc. After mosaicing, the distortions are mostly removed and the OCR results are improved markedly. Experimental results show that the proposed method can resolve the issue of warped document image recognition more effectively.
